GAME RECAP

OHA U17 Midget AAA squeaks by Kemptville Midget AAA, 4-3

Pembroke Community Center    Sat, Feb 27, 2016

The OHA U17 Midget AAA OHA U16 gutted out a close 4-3 win against the Kemptville Midget AAA 73s.

No lead was more than one goal during the contest, and the winning goal was scored by Andre Guldbrandsen at 15:03 of the third period.

Nikita Lopatin had a great game for OHA U17 Midget AAA, netting two goals. Lopatin's tallies came on the power play at 14:34 into the second period to make the score 2-1 OHA U17 Midget AAA and 12:04 into the third to make the score 3-3.

The OHA U16's penalty kill was spotless, allowing no goals on three Kemptville Midget AAA power plays.

Shane Ford also scored for OHA U17 Midget AAA. Other players who recorded assists for OHA U17 Midget AAA were Nicholas Abbott, who had two and Matthew Edgecombe, Tanner Brown, Thomas Callaghan, Curtis Egert, and Dylan Coffey, who each chipped in one.

Kemptville Midget AAA was helped by Devin Saumur, who finished with one goal. Saumur scored 4:35 into the third period to make the score 3-2 Kemptville Midget AAA. Dean Bucciarelli provided the assist. Others who scored for Kemptville Midget AAA included Mike Armstrong and Jarrett Williams, who scored one goal each. More assists for Kemptville Midget AAA came via Zach Cohen, Joel Holtrop, and Brady Elder, who contributed one each.

Dillon Lamarche made 21 saves for OHA U17 Midget AAA on 24 shots. The OHA U16 incurred eight minutes in penalty time with four minors. Jacob Dioszeghy recorded 25 saves for the 73s. Kemptville Midget AAA incurred eight minutes in penalty time with four minors.
